Happiness comes from within and not from external things. What money and external possessions provide are only distractions from the unhappiness and lack of fulfillment in one’s life. We can only gain brief pleasures through external things. It will never last for long and slowly those things will lose it’s initial appeal. Sadly, many people respond to that through looking for more external things to distract them.
Do not get into the cycle of continuously pursuing more and more external things. Don’t seek for brief pleasures but rather focus on obtaining true happiness that comes from within. To do that, we must change our lifestyle to one that promotes true happiness.
The main reason why some people are happy is because they have a different attitude to unhappy people. They look at the world differently, they think differently and they interpret experiences differently. Happy people choose to focus on the positive, they never blame others. Whenever they face setbacks they view it as valuable experiences, not failures. They don’t take life too seriously. They know that life is short and every moment alive is a gift.
Change your outlook of life and you will start to experience more happiness. Below are some ways to cultivate true happiness.
1. Practice gratitude 2. Listen to happy music 3. Read inspirational stories, quotes and poems about happiness 4. Smile and laugh 5. Set aside time to do a hobby or activity that you enjoy 6. Learn to appreciate the beauty in the world 7. Help others
Often times we fail to give happiness the priority it deserves. We don’t commit and give importance to making ourselves happy. No wonder we’re always unhappy. Commit to happiness and consistently do the actions in the list above. Happiness like everything else, requires effort too.
